What physical role does a laboratory press play in pressing lignin-based paper? Optimize fiber & lignin integration.


The laboratory press acts as the primary mechanical driver for integrating lignin into the fiber matrix during the initial phase of paper formation. In room-temperature pressing, the machine applies vertical force to embed lignin powder into the handsheet structure while utilizing radial flow to ensure even distribution across the surface. This mechanical phase is essential for establishing the initial physical contact required between fibers and lignin particles before any thermal consolidation occurs.

Room-temperature pressing serves as a mechanical preparation phase that forces lignin into the handsheet structure and distributes it uniformly through pressure-induced radial flow. This process establishes the necessary contact between the lignin and cellulose fibers, creating the structural foundation required for subsequent processing.

Mechanisms of Lignin Integration

Vertical Force and Particle Embedding

The laboratory press exerts precise vertical pressure that drives lignin powder deep into the porous network of the wet handsheet. This action forces the particles to redeposit directly onto the fiber surfaces, preventing the lignin from remaining a loose, external layer.

Pressure-Induced Radial Flow

As pressure is applied to the wet sheet, it generates a radial flow of moisture and particles. This lateral movement is the primary mechanism for achieving a uniform distribution of lignin across the entire surface area of the paper, eliminating localized concentrations.

Establishing Structural Foundations

Initial Contact and Proximity

The primary physical goal of this phase is to minimize the distance between the lignin particles and the cellulose fibers. By creating this initial close contact, the press prepares the material for the strong bonding that occurs during later thermal consolidation.

Simulation of Industrial Dehydration

The laboratory press simulates the dehydration and pressing stages of industrial papermaking. This allows researchers to evaluate how fibers—particularly those that are rigid or have low elasticity—will respond to mechanical stress and whether they will form a stable sheet.

Understanding the Trade-offs

Uniformity vs. Fiber Damage

Excessive pressure during the room-temperature phase can lead to fiber crushing or irreversible structural damage. It is a delicate balance between applying enough force to achieve lignin redeposition and maintaining the inherent mechanical strength of the fiber network.

Moisture Calibration and Flow

If the moisture content of the wet sheet is too low, the radial flow will be insufficient to distribute the lignin uniformly. Conversely, excessive moisture can lead to "washout" where the lignin is pushed out of the sheet entirely rather than being embedded within it.

Applying These Principles to Your Process

How to Apply This to Your Project

To achieve the best results during the pressing phase, consider your specific material goals:

  • If your primary focus is uniform lignin distribution: Calibrate the moisture levels of your handsheet to facilitate optimal radial flow during the pressing cycle.
  • If your primary focus is structural integrity: Monitor the vertical pressure limits closely to ensure you are embedding the lignin without crushing rigid cellulose fibers.
  • If your primary focus is electrochemical performance: Use the press to maximize the density of the material, ensuring the tightest possible contact between the lignin-derived carbon and the current collector.

Mastering the mechanical dynamics of the room-temperature phase allows for precise control over the final structural and functional properties of lignin-integrated paper.
